LEACH-EE: 基于LEACH协议的节能聚类路由算法
需积分: 10 22 浏览量
更新于2024-09-23
收藏 360KB PDF 举报
"基于LEACH协议的高效聚类路由算法,旨在优化传感器网络的能效,延长网络寿命。LEACH-EE算法通过簇头收集数据,建立多跳路径至基站,减轻簇头负担并改善能量消耗。
LEACH(Low-Energy Adaptive Clustering Hierarchy)协议是一种广泛用于无线传感器网络的节能聚类路由协议。它的基本思想是将网络中的节点分为多个簇,每个簇有一个簇头,负责收集簇内其他节点的数据,并将其转发到基站。然而,LEACH协议的一个主要问题是簇头节点由于处理和转发大量数据而快速消耗能量,导致网络寿命缩短。
LEACH-EE(基于LEACH的高效能量效率聚类路由算法)是对LEACH协议的一种改进。该算法关注于解决LEACH中簇头能耗过高的问题,以实现更均衡的能量消耗。在LEACH-EE中,簇头的选举策略进行了优化,使得每个节点成为簇头的机会更加公平,从而避免了某些节点过早耗尽能量的情况。此外,LEACH-EE引入了多跳通信的概念,簇头之间不再直接将所有数据发送给基站,而是通过与其他簇头协作,找到一条能量效率最高的多跳路径。这种方法可以分散数据传输的负担,减少单个节点的压力,进而提高整个网络的生存时间。
在LEACH-EE算法中,簇头首先收集其簇内的传感器数据,然后这些簇头通过优化算法寻找一条到基站的最短、最低能耗的多跳路径。这条路径可能经过其他簇头,直至数据到达基站。簇头之间的通信路径选择考虑了各个节点的剩余能量,确保能量的均衡利用。此外,数据融合技术也在LEACH-EE中被应用,通过合并相似数据,进一步减少了需要传输的数据量,从而节省了能量。
实验结果证明,LEACH-EE算法有效地降低了网络的能量消耗,延长了网络寿命,相较于LEACH协议具有更高的能效。这种优化的聚类路由策略对于大规模无线传感器网络的可持续运行至关重要,特别是在环境监测、灾害预警等领域,其中网络寿命和能效是关键考量因素。
LEACH-EE算法是针对LEACH协议在能量效率方面的不足进行的改进,它通过更合理的簇头选举、多跳通信和数据融合,实现了更均衡的能量消耗,提高了传感器网络的整体性能和生存时间。这种高效的聚类路由策略对于无线传感器网络的部署和应用具有重要的实践价值。
2011-04-19 上传
2021-10-05 上传
2015-07-13 上传
2021-09-29 上传
2021-04-25 上传
2019-07-22 上传
2021-05-24 上传
点击了解资源详情
oxwangfeng
- 粉丝: 18
- 资源: 193
最新资源
- Angular程序高效加载与展示海量Excel数据技巧
- Argos客户端开发流程及Vue配置指南
- 基于源码的PHP Webshell审查工具介绍
- Mina任务部署Rpush教程与实践指南
- 密歇根大学主题新标签页壁纸与多功能扩展
- Golang编程入门:基础代码学习教程
- Aplysia吸引子分析MATLAB代码套件解读
- 程序性竞争问题解决实践指南
- lyra: Rust语言实现的特征提取POC功能
- Chrome扩展:NBA全明星新标签壁纸
- 探索通用Lisp用户空间文件系统clufs_0.7
- dheap: Haxe实现的高效D-ary堆算法
- 利用BladeRF实现简易VNA频率响应分析工具
- 深度解析Amazon SQS在C#中的应用实践
- 正义联盟计划管理系统:udemy-heroes-demo-09
- JavaScript语法jsonpointer替代实现介绍